Timothy Bryan Majors

1992 ∼ 2017

Timothy Bryan Majors, 25, of Daisetta, died Sunday March 5, 2017 in Raywood, TX

A service of remembrance will be Sunday March 12, 2017 at 2:00 P.M. at Faith & Family Funeral Services Chapel. There will be a gathering of family and friends on Sunday from 1:00 P.M. until time of service at Faith & Family.

Timothy was a 2010 graduate of Hull-Daisetta High School and was employed at Liberty-Dayton Regional Medical Center as an IT Tech. He had lived in Daisetta most of his life. He loved a variety of music, and enjoyed playing it more than listening. Another hobby he loved was, in a general sense, computers. From gaming on his computer to printing 3D figures, aslong as he had his computer he was happy. He loved to watch Anime, of many kind. It is hard to say which of these he did most, it all depended on the time and day.

Timothy is preceded in death by his brother William, Grandfather Delbert Majors, Grandmother Bessie Wilkinson, and Aunts Debbie Thompson and Deeya Wilson.

Those left to cherish his memories are his parents, Dean and Nina Majors, Brother Jonathan “Cody” Majors and his wife Jessica along with their children Blaine and Anastasia, Grandmother Shirley Ewing, special friend Emily McNeil, along with a host of Aunts, Uncles, Cousins and Friends.
